Maple Candied Bacon Recipe

Maple candied bacon goes with just about anything. We really like it in David's salad.

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Cuisine Cast Iron Cooking
Servings 12 2 tablespoons
Calories 252 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 pound Bacon thick cut, cut into 3/4" wide pieces
  • 1 cup Pure Maple Syrup
  • 1 teaspoon Black Pepper
  • 2 tablespoons Brown Sugar

Instructions
 

  • Place bacon in a cool cast iron skillet; turn heat to medium. Cook until bacon is crispy, but not burnt (about 10-12 minutes).
  • Remove bacon from skillet and pat dry. Drain most of the bacon grease from skillet, leaving only about 1-2 tsp in skillet.
  • In a medium bowl, mix together the maple syrup, black pepper, and brown sugar. Stir until combined. Add the cooked bacon and stir until bacon is well coated.
  • Return the coated bacon pieces to the skillet and cook on low heat for 8-10 minutes or until sugar has melted and begun to turn thick. (Note: you will need to stir the bacon pieces fairly often during this stage to prevent the sugar and maple mixture from burning.)
  • Remove the bacon pieces from the skillet and spread them apart on a piece of parchment paper to dry (about 4-5 minutes).
